I like EE's and Austrolorp because they're big, sturdy hens that lay well, but they're very gentle - great for being toted around by kids. We have two Austrolorp and three EE's. It's always fun to give people the blue eggs!

I agree the price of feed (hay too) is close to outrageous these days. I save every suitable scrap of food from my kitchen to supplement the grain. My flock gets so excited when they see me coming with the treat bucket: sweet potato peels, left over mashed potatoes, mushy berries, scrambled eggs, spinach, sprouts, and of course old bread!
